Anna Wiener

Anna Wiener, the distinguished author of "Uncanny Valley: A Memoir," crafts a literary tapestry that intricately weaves the personal with the universal, casting a discerning eye upon the tech world that so potently shapes modern existence. Her book unfurls not simply as a memoir but as a reflective bio of an epoch defined by silicon dreams and digital discontents. Wiener's narrative journey from the literary streets of Brooklyn to the tech-laden avenues of San Francisco is more than geographical; it marks a pilgrimage into the heart of society's most profound transformations.
